Eat your Kimchi's Review of Itaewon's Foreign Restaurant

OK. I'm not a big fan of the Foreign Restaurant in Itaewon. Maybe it's because I've just had some subpar experiences there. Now that my favorite Indian place, Wazwan, hasn't been serving up the deliciousness these days. So, I might have to search for a new place to get my Palak Paneer fix. Chakraa has been my place of choice these days, but I can be persuaded to eat.


